1. Constipation and Gut Microbiome Testing: Unraveling the Connection
What is Constipation? Constipation is medically defined as having fewer than three bowel movements per week. But in practical terms, it often means hard, small, and dry stools that are difficult to pass or the sensation of incomplete evacuation. In cases where someone is only passing small amounts of stool frequently, it may point to incomplete evacuation—a subtler form of constipation.
Microbiome and Constipation
The gut microbiome is integral to healthy digestion. A balanced gut contains diverse microbial species that aid in breaking down food, producing short-chain fatty acids (SCFAs) that stimulate gut motility, and managing inflammation. When microbial imbalance—also known as dysbiosis—occurs, it can slow down these processes, often leading to constipation or altered stool output.
Studies show that individuals with chronic constipation often have:
- Lower microbial diversity
- Reduced levels of Bifidobacteria and Lactobacillus
- Overgrowth of methane-producing archaea like Methanobrevibacter smithii, which reduce gut transit speed

2. Bowel Movement Issues and the Microbiome: Understanding Abnormalities
Constipation is just one piece of the bowel health puzzle. Other issues such as diarrhea, gas, bloating, incomplete evacuation, and small but frequent stools can all point to dysfunction within the gut. The underlying cause? Often, it’s tied to the microbiome.
The Microbial Impact
The gut microbiome influences:
- Peristalsis (rhythmic movement) of the bowels
- Fermentation and gas production
- Stool hydration via mucus and ion transport regulation
- Immune modulation and gut lining integrity
Dysbiosis and Symptoms
An imbalance in the bacteria that govern these processes can lead to small, irregular stools due to issues like:
- Loss of motility-enhancing bacteria
- Excess gas-producing species causing bloating and stool fragmentation
- Inflammatory shifts that reduce nutrient absorption and impair regularity
Some individuals with irritable bowel syndrome (IBS) experience alternating small hard stools and loose bowel movements—a dysfunction likely influenced by gut flora irregularities.

5. Stool Frequency and Microbiome Variations: Insights Through Testing
Stool frequency varies widely, but generally, between three times per day to three times per week is considered normal. Individuals passing small stools several times a day—without achieving relief—may be dealing with an undisclosed gut rhythm problem.
How the Microbiome Impacts Frequency
Gut microbes help set the pace of bowel rhythms. Certain bacteria stimulate the myenteric neurons that manage peristalsis. Microbiome imbalances such as overgrowth of methane-producing microbes slow intestinal movement, while some pathogens increase urgency, leading to small but frequent eliminations.

6. Stool Consistency and Microbial Diversity: Decoding Microbiome-Related Changes
Stool consistency is a rich indicator of gut health. The Bristol Stool Scale categorizes stool types from type 1 (hard pebbles) to type 7 (entirely liquid). Consistently small and hard stools often reflect constipation-related issues or microbial deficits that influence water absorption or fiber fermentation.
Microbial Determinants
Diverse microbiota help maintain ideal consistency by:
- Lubricating stool through mucus production via SCFAs
- Retaining water by optimizing colon water balance
- Maintaining gut lining tight junctions for effective transit
